Shreyas Iyer to head Punjab Kings’ table at IPL 2026 auction, but no Ricky Ponting for runners-up: Report

Shreyas

Punjab Kings are set for a significant change in their auction-room leadership at the IPL 2026 mini-auction, with captain Shreyas Iyer confirmed to head the franchise’s table in Abu Dhabi. However, the team will be without their head coach Ricky Ponting, who will miss the event due to prior broadcasting commitments during the Ashes series. Reports indicate that Iyer will be one of the eight representatives allowed at the auction table, taking charge of Punjab Kings’ bidding strategy as they look to strengthen their squad for the upcoming season.

The development comes at a crucial time for Punjab Kings, who finished as runners-up in IPL 2025, marking their best performance in over a decade. With only a few slots left to fill and a purse of ₹11.50 crore, the franchise is expected to make targeted moves rather than sweeping changes.

✅ Background: Why Shreyas Iyer Will Lead the Table

Shreyas Iyer, who joined Punjab Kings ahead of IPL 2025, played a pivotal role in transforming the team’s fortunes. Under his captaincy, PBKS reached the final for the first time in 11 years, with Iyer also emerging as the team’s leading run-scorer with 604 runs in the season.

His strong rapport with the coaching staff and deep understanding of team requirements have made him a natural choice to represent the franchise at the auction. With Ponting unavailable, Iyer’s presence ensures continuity in strategy and clarity in decision-making.

✅ Why Ponting Will Miss the Auction

Ricky Ponting, one of the most influential coaches in the IPL, will be unavailable due to his commentary commitments with Channel Seven for the Ashes series in Australia.

Given that Punjab Kings have minimal business to conduct at the auction, the franchise reportedly does not view his absence as a setback. The core team, including analysts and support staff, will accompany Iyer to ensure a smooth decision-making process.
